Contributor, Benzinga
February 21, 2020

FREE Trial with Benzinga Pro happening right now!

Interested in learning how to speak Spanish but don’t know where to start? Online courses are an ideal option to master the fundamentals or advance your knowledge if you already know the basics. 

Classes are available for all skill levels and budgets. So, let Benzinga lead the way as you begin your journey to find the perfect course to learn Spanish. 

Quick Look: Best Spanish Courses 

Why Learn How to Speak Spanish?

There are many reasons why an online Spanish course is a worthwhile investment. Plus, you never know when Spanish skills will come in handy.

1. Communicate with Native Speakers

If you live in an area that’s also home to native speakers, it’s helpful to learn Spanish so you can communicate with others more effectively. Even if it’s just general conversations about everyday topics, some knowledge can help you knock down the language barrier. 

2. Prepare for an Upcoming Trip 

Planning to take an extended vacation or study abroad in a Spanish-speaking country? Instead of heading over with little to no knowledge of the language, consider taking online Spanish courses to learn the basics. 

This will help you communicate with locals and complete simple tasks, like find your terminal in the airport, order food or ask about a product in a store. And if time permits, consider more advanced courses to help advance your comprehension skills and hold meaningful conversations.

3. Boost Your Resume 

There are jobs for bilingual speakers in many industries. So if you add Spanish language knowledge to your resume, you could position yourself for career advancement opportunities. 

Our Top Spanish Courses

Below, you’ll find Benzinga’s top Spanish course selections from Rosetta Stone and Udemy. Our top picks all interactive and implement immersion to help you learn the language faster. 

We’ve categorized the courses by skill level to make your search easier. Also, you’ll notice a description and enrollment fee to help you find the best fit. 

Courses For Beginners

Consider these beginner courses to get your feet wet and start learning Spanish. 

1. Spanish 1 — Spanish Course for Beginners by Udemy 

Spanish 1 — Spanish Course for Beginners

Start learning Spanish today with this introductory course from Udemy. It includes lessons on the alphabet, personal pronouns, basic vocabulary and everyday expressions. You will also learn time, the days of the week, simple sentence structures and a few cultural lessons along the way. 

Get instant access to 47 video lectures in Spanish with English subtitles, 94 downloadable resources and 1 article the moment you register. And you can access the contents of the course offline when you’re on the go. 

The class is presented by Spanish To Move, a leading online Spanish course provider. 

2. Spanish 2 — Basic Proficiency by Udemy

Spanish 2 — Basic Proficiency
  • Who it's for: Beginners
  • Price: On sale

Also presented by Spanish To Move, this beginner course introduces additional vocabulary and commonly-used phrases in the Spanish language. The class caters to beginners and helps boost comprehension and Spanish speaking skills so you can communicate with native speakers.

Comprised of 43 lectures, Spanish 2 - Basic Proficiency includes lessons on how to share descriptions of people, objects and situations. It also covers locating addresses in Spanish and how to request and share personal information. 

Complete Spanish 1 — Spanish Course for Beginners by Udemy before you enroll. You should also have some Spanish vocabulary in your arsenal and know how to use verbs in the present tense. 

3. Learn Spanish by Rosetta Stone

Learn Spanish

Start your Spanish journey off in a fun-filled way with Rosetta Stone. They’re the leading online provider of foreign language education and boast more than 25 years of experience in the field. 

Learn Spanish features a fully-immersive curriculum with short 10-minute lessons to help you learn the language more quickly. Plus, you can benefit from the TruAccent speech-recognition software to improve pronunciation skills. The course material is also accessible offline. 

Enrollment starts at $79 for a 3-month subscription. Upgrade to 12- or 24-months for $119.88 and $167.76, respectively. You can also purchase a lifetime subscription for only $199. And they offer a 30-day money-back guarantee if the course doesn’t work for you. 

Best Intermediate Spanish Courses

Have a solid grasp of the basics of the Spanish language? Move on to these intermediate courses. 

4. Complete Spanish Course: Spanish Language for Intermediates by Udemy


Complete Spanish Course: Spanish Language | Intermediate
  • Who it's for: Intermediate students
  • Price: On sale

This Udemy course from AbcEdu Online teaches higher-level Spanish language rules as they relate to writing, pronunciation and grammar. You will also enhance your comprehension and communication skills. 

Enroll today to access 21 lectures condensed into 4 hours of on-demand video in Spanish with English subtitles. The course also includes 21 downloadable, printable PDFs and demo lessons, as well as multiple-choice tests to test your knowledge as you complete the lessons. 

It’s a good idea to take Complete Spanish Course: Learn Spanish Language if you don’t yet have a basic knowledge of the Spanish language. 

5. Communicate in Spanish — Low Intermediate by Udemy

Communicate in Spanish — Low Intermediate
  • Who it's for: Intermediate students 
  • Price: On sale

Interested in having more in-depth conversations in Spanish with native speakers? This course is for you. 

It includes 1.5 hours of on-demand video that teaches storytelling in Spanish. You’ll also learn how to engage in conversations while shopping, describe past events and discuss important matters with medical providers. 

The course includes 25 downloadable resources and 6 articles to supplement your learning. It is facilitated by Margarita Cuadros, a certified Spanish teacher. 

Know the basics of the Spanish language before you sign up. It’s helpful if you can introduce yourself, describe your occupation and communicate your hobbies to others in Spanish using the present tense. 

6. Spanish 3 — Intermediate Level Spanish Course by Udemy 

Spanish 3 — Intermediate Level Spanish Course
  • Who it's for: Intermediate students 
  • Price: On sale

This course is the 3rd installment in the series from Spanish To Move. It focuses on comprehension and aims to help increase your fluency. 

Spanish 3 - Intermediate Level Spanish Course features lessons on tourism, general culture, history, literature and psychology. You’ll learn more about the grammatical structure native Spanish speakers use in casual communications when speaking in the past, present or future tense. 

Take advantage of the stellar deal Udemy’s offering today by registering for the course. You’ll have instant access to 5 hours of on-demand video, 93 downloadable resources and 1 article. 

It’s best to complete Spanish 1 — Spanish Course for Beginners and Spanish 2 — Basic Proficiency before you register. 

Best Advanced Spanish Courses

Learn advanced vocabulary, improve your pronunciation and comprehension skills and sound like a Spanish-speaking native through our top picks for advanced learners. 

7. Speaking Practice: Conversational Spanish by Udemy

Speaking Practice: Conversational Spanish
  • Who it's for: Advanced students 
  • Price: On sale

Are you an intermediate level Spanish speaker who wants to hone your skills even more? Consider this advanced course from Udemy to lend a helping hand. 

Facilitator Max La Runa employs an interactive approach to boost your Spanish communication skills. You will engage in several interactive question-and-answer sessions that require oral responses. 

Enroll now to take advantage of the discounted registration fee. It’s available for a limited time only. 

8. Improve Your Spanish Listening Comprehension by Udemy

Improve Your Spanish Listening Comprehension
  • Who it's for: Advanced students 
  • Price: Free

Sharpen your Spanish comprehension skills for free by enrolling in Improve Your Spanish Listening Comprehension from Udemy. This course caters to intermediate and advanced Spanish students. 

In a little under an hour, instructor Nikki Joslin, an experienced Spanish and English teacher, shares listening techniques to facilitate comprehension of more complex topics. You will also have access to 4 articles and 10 downloadable resources when you sign up. 

9. Spanish 4 — Advanced Spanish Course by Udemy 

Spanish 4 — Advanced Spanish Course
  • Who it's for: Advanced students 
  • Price: On sale

The final component of the Spanish To Move series delves into listening comprehension in Spanish as it relates to specialized subjects. These include politics, humanities, religion, science, economics and business. 

Course material is delivered via 4.5 hours of on-demand video lectures, 93 downloadable resources and 1 digital article. 

You need intermediate Spanish knowledge before you register. It’s also best if you know how to conjugate verbs in the past, simple present and future tenses. 

Start Learning Spanish Today

Learning how to speak Spanish can help you hold more engaging conversations or pave the way for career advancement opportunities. An online Spanish course is also a good use of your time and an investment in your education. 

When you’re ready to get started, consider a course from our list of recommendations. If you’re a novice, build a solid foundation with an introductory class, then move on to more intermediate and advanced options when you’re ready. Check out Benzinga's Best Online Spanish Courses article for more courses.

Southern New Hampshire University Online

SNHU Online Offers:

  1. Flexible schedules
  2. Affordable tuition
  3. Online tutoring
  4. Access to electronic research materials
  5. Specialized academic advising
  6. Supportive online community